Fiberglass Geogrid – is a kind of plane network shape material that selects excellent reinforcement non-alkali fiberglass yarn. It is weaven in to base material by using foreign advanced warp knitter and adopts warp knitted directional structure, It make full use of yarn strength in textile, improves its chemical performance and makes it have good tension resistance, tearing resistance and creep resistance and is formed by excellent modified asphalt coating treatment. It follows similar and compatible principle, lays stress on its synthetic performance with asphalt mixture, protects glass fiber base material full and improve wearing resistance and sharing force resistance of base material so as to make road surface reinforce, to prevent highway harm such as crack and rut from occurring and to solve the problem that asphalt rode surface is difficult for reinforcement.

What is the advantages of using fiberglass geogrid in paving roads?
Fiberglass geogrid features increased strength, excellent durability, improved load bearing capacity, superior weed suppression, and improved drainage.
In terms of strength, fiberglass geogrids are highly resistant to tension and strain due to their strong interlocking glass fibers. This makes them an ideal choice for reinforcing pavement layers, such as asphalt and concrete. The increased strength provided by fiberglass geogrid can help prevent cracking, rutting, and other types of damage that weaken pavement over time.
Fiberglass geogrid also has excellent durability. Unlike some other materials, fiberglass is able to resist the effects of UV radiation, extreme temperatures, dirt, water, and other sources of wear and tear. This makes it well suited for use in areas with extreme climates or environments. For example, the moisture and salt content in coastal areas can cause other materials to prematurely degrade. Fiberglass geogrid is not affected by these environmental factors and can last for many years, making it an economical choice.

In terms of load bearing capacity, fiberglass geogrids are designed to disperse weight evenly throughout the entire pavement system. This reduces pressure on any one spot and allows for thicker pavement layers while still providing support and stability. As a result, roads constructed with fiberglass geogrid can handle heavier loads without significant degradation over time.
Fiberglass geogrids also provide superior weed suppression. In any pavement system, weeds and grass can easily take root and grow between cracks and joints. Fiberglass geogrids act as a barrier that prevents the growth of weeds while allowing water to move through the soil. This helps reduce maintenance costs because it eliminates the need to regularly remove weeds from the road surface.
Fiberglass geogrids enable improved drainage. This is especially beneficial in areas where there is significant rainfall or runoff. The strong interlocking networks of glass fibers prevent water from puddling on the road surface and allow it to quickly move away into ditches, curbs, gutters, or other drainage systems. This helps maintain a safe and usable road surface in wet weather.
